He hates to fly…
But there Junior Agent Renner Graves is, standing on the ledge of Roslyn, Virginia’s tallest high-rise and about to fall to his death. If only he hadn’t mistakenly cuffed himself to the beautiful cat burglar on the ledge with him. If only he hadn’t assumed she was the serial murderer he was stalking. It’s a long way down, but he can’t go back inside. Renner has to jump. With his new lady friend. Can he do it? Does he dare?
Better question, will they live?

She’s a woman in hiding…
Once an Olympic hopeful, Tara is now running from her ex-husband, an ISIS terrorist. The world has become a frightening place for the once audacious risk-taker. She can’t trust anyone… until she encounters a brash, over-confident man while she’s robbing a local penthouse. She knows she’s met her match when he cuffs them together, but is this guy brave or strong enough to take her on? Is he as good as he seems? There’s only one way to find out.
They have to fall—together.

Irish Winters' Bio

I always wanted to be a writer. I've dabbled in poetry, short stories, and more daydreaming than most. I remember long Sunday afternoon drives with my parents where they would tell us eight kids to: 'Look out the window and see something!' I've been looking out the window ever since.... In the great pines of the Pacific Northwest, I saw a woman with nowhere to run find refuge in the arms of a tender warrior who'd forgotten the man he once was... In the hills of Wyoming, I saw a man broken by the high cost of war, rediscover himself in the eyes of a pretty girl... And in the Dairy State, (yes Wisconsin), I saw two people overcome horrific obstacles on their way to happily-ever-after. Life is short. Pick up a good book. Read. Write. Enjoy.
